Creative Associate

Remote

Think Big Media seeks a motivated creative associate to create impactful digital visuals for our advocacy and public affairs clients. This role reports to the Associate Creative Director.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design digital assets (social media, display ads), web assets (header banners, icons)

  • Create social videos with a mix of text, graphics, photos, animations, and music

  • Build and maintain Canva brand kits and client-facing templates so stakeholders can execute on-brand content independently

  • Collaborate with team members and account managers to understand project needs and translate client briefs into visuals

  • An understanding of web design, being able to do basic edits across platforms such as wix
    or squarespace.

  • Use AI design tools (Adobe Firefly, Gemini, Midjourney, or similar) to accelerate
    concepting and production — as a real workflow asset, not a shortcut

  • Maintain industry-standard knowledge of file types and usages

  • Stay current with design trends and evolving software, including emerging AI tools

  • Be flexible and nimble on both graphic and motion work, making quick edits and producing timely deliverables

  • Work within brand guidelines across multiple clients simultaneously

Qualifications

  • You're a Swiss Army Knife creative who can move quickly across a variety of content types and platforms

  • Bachelor's in Graphic Design, Communication, Marketing or related field OR proven content creation experience with a strong portfolio (portfolio required)

  • 1–2 years of related work in content creation

  • Demonstrated proficiency in graphic design, basic video editing, and/or motion graphics 

  • Working knowledge of Adobe Creative Cloud: Photoshop, Illustrator, and After Effects

  • Canva fluency — including brand kit setup, template creation, and working within client-managed workspaces

  • Familiarity with AI tools in a design or production workflow; comfort experimenting with new tools as they emerge

  • Appreciation for standard processes and the human-centered systems that help us do our most effective and efficient work together.

  • Ability to juggle multiple projects with tight deadlines and self-start on tasks

  • Able to thrive in a fast-paced, campaign-style environment

  • Knowledge of politics, policy, or advocacy communications is helpful, but not required
